Popular places to visit

Hastings Castle
Stir your imagination at the ruins of this once mighty clifftop fortress, built by William the Conqueror in the 11th century.

East Hill Lift
Step aboard this historic funicular railway and enjoy views of the fishing fleet and rows of net shops on the seafront.

Hastings Country Park
Popular with dog walkers and exercisers, this expansive park provides a peaceful escape and coastal panoramas.

Smugglers Adventure
Venture inside a series of caves and caverns and learn about the exploits of the smugglers who once operated on the Sussex coast.

Hastings Museum and Art Gallery
This interesting museum covers an eclectic range of topics, including Native Americans and John Logie Baird, the inventor of the television.
